Why ASO usually needs a team - and why that is changing

A conventional ASO function splits across several roles: someone researches keywords, someone writes and tests metadata, someone produces creative, someone reads the data. Each role exists because each task is high volume and ongoing. That is why ASO has historically demanded headcount.

Almost all of that volume work is now automatable. An autonomous ASO platform expands keywords, drafts metadata, generates creative directions, and monitors rankings continuously. The roles do not disappear - the execution inside them gets absorbed by AI-powered ASO. What is left for a human is the judgment, and judgment is the one thing a single capable person can supply across the whole function.

The solo ASO operating model

Scaling ASO without a team comes down to one principle: automate the volume, own the decisions. Here is the model.

Reserve the few decisions only you should make

You keep four things: strategy (what to rank for and why), positioning, brand voice, and final approval on high-traffic surfaces. These need business context, and they do not consume much time. Everything else is a candidate for automation.

Let an autonomous ASO platform run the loop

Hand the rest to the platform:

  • Keyword discovery and scoring. The automated ASO platform expands seeds into thousands of candidates and ranks them by opportunity.
  • Metadata drafting. AI-powered ASO produces compliant title, subtitle, keyword, and description variants.
  • Creative variants. The platform generates on-brief directions so your testing queue stays full.
  • Monitoring. Rankings across keywords and locales are tracked continuously, with alerts only on real movement.

Batch approvals into a weekly cadence

The trap that burns out solo operators is touching ASO every day. Do not. Let the autonomous ASO platform accumulate output, then review and approve once a week. A few focused hours of judgment beats daily firefighting, and it is how one person sustains the workload indefinitely.

Scale across apps and locales by repeating the loop

This is the payoff. Because the heavy lifting is automated, adding a second app or a new market costs you approval time, not a new hire. The same autonomous ASO loop runs across your whole portfolio. Headcount stops being the constraint on how many apps or locales you can cover.

Guardrails so solo ASO stays safe

Running ASO without a specialist on staff is safe only with guardrails. Make sure your automated ASO platform enforces:

  • Character limits on every metadata field.
  • Banned-term and trademark screening before anything is drafted for the store.
  • A mandatory approval gate so nothing ships without your sign-off.
  • Rollback rules if a change hurts conversion or retention.

With those in place, autonomous ASO does not mean unsupervised ASO. It means the machine handles execution and you stay accountable for outcomes.

A realistic week

Here is what scaling ASO without a team actually looks like in practice:

  • Monday, 2 to 3 hours: review the platform's keyword and metadata output from the prior week, approve the safe wins, flag anything off-brand.
  • Midweek: the autonomous ASO platform runs experiments and monitoring without you.
  • Friday, 1 hour: check experiment results the platform has analyzed and queue the next cycle.

That is a full ASO function in roughly half a day a week, across as many apps as you run.
